Crude import bill down 11% in April-November
India’s crude import bill declined by 11% to $80.9 billion during April-November of FY26, compared with $91.9 billion in the year-ago period thanks to lower prices, according to data from the government’s petroleum planning and analysis cell.
The country imported 163.4 million tonnes (MT) of crude oil during April to November, up from 159.5 million tonnes in the same period of previous fiscal.
